Crisp Victory Readies Juan For Grand National

3 minute read

Veteran jumper Juan Carlos has readied himself for a third Grand National Steeplechase tilt next fortnight with a workmanlike victory in the $100,000 Crisp Steeplechase at Betfair Park Sandown this afternoon.

Going over the jumps for just the second time this preparation, eleven-year-old stalwart Juan Carlos was the focus of solid support in betting to claim this afternoon's $100,000 Crisp Steeplechase (3900m) at Betfair Park Sandown.

Reunited with Juan Carlos after two years apart, jockey Gerrad Gilmour showed patience aboard the son of Encosta De Lago allowing the veteran to settle midfield as Plumtastic led at a strong tempo.

After going over the jumps with minimal fuss, Gilmour began to ask from Juan Carlos just before the turn and he responded by gradually making ground on the leaders.

A long sustained run by the Allison Bennett-trained Juan Carlos resulted in the eleven-year-old striking the front just inside a furlong out.

Juan Carlos then survived a late challenge from race favourite Kerdem (2nd) to record his biggest career win over the jumps by claiming the $100,000 Crisp Steeplechase (3900m).

“He is a great horse, we just love him,” Bennett said.

“His longevity is fantastic. He is a beautiful horse to have around the stables, everyone loves him.

“It is really nice for him to come out and do this.”

Despite getting on now in years there have been no thoughts amongst connections of retiring Juan Carlos who are instead looking forward to the $200,000 Grand National Steeplechase (4500m) at Betfair Park Sandown next fortnight.

“He loves it [racing],” Bennett said.

“He would be bored stiff otherwise. He loves stable life, he is a beautiful horse to have around as he is always smiling.

“He doesn't know he is 11, he thinks he is three.”

Jockey Gerrad Gilmour has now ridden Juan Carlos at six starts for two wins and two minor placings.

Gilmour's other success aboard Juan Carlos came in May 2009 when the warhorse won his debut over the hurdles at Mornington.

“He is a cracking old horse,” Gilmour said.

“It has probably been a few years since I've been on him.

“I did all of his education early days, had a few unlucky runs on him and then Steven [Pateman] was fortunate enough to get the ride on him.

“Allison rang me Sunday night and asked me if I would be happy to jump back on the old boy and I said 'I would love to'.”

From 87 starts Juan Carlos has now won well in excess of $300,000 in prizemoney.

The gelding can greatly add to this tally next fortnight on August 28 when he contests the $200,000 Grand National Steeplechase (4500m) at Betfair Park Sandown.

Juan Carlos has twice been runner up of a Grand National, finishing second behind Desert Master (Hurdle) and Morsonique (Steeplechase) in 2009 and 2010 respectively.

Today's 3900m steeplechase event contained one fall with Darren Weir-trained Pay The Aces dislodging rider John Allen at the eighth jump.

Both horse and rider are reported to be unharmed.


*After the running of the race the Club's veterinary surgeon reported Juan Carlos had bled from its near side nostril. Trainer Ms Allison Bennett was advised a veterinary certificate of fitness and the satisfactory results of an endoscopic examination after a 1000m gallop are required prior to Juan Carlos racing again.
